OPT OnDemand is a full-service B2B platform that provides on-demand fulfillment services worldwide. The company has been in business for 20 years and operates from a facility spanning over 100,000 square feet, running 24/7 operations.
The company specializes in a hybrid fulfillment model that combines on-demand production with warehousing services. They offer multiple decorating technologies including DTG (Direct to Garment) printing, screen printing, paper and wall art printing, flex/flock, dye-sublimation, and embroidery. Their equipment includes industrial machines from brands like Kornit, Brother, M&R, TAS, Epson, Canon, Mimaki, Sefa, and Tajima.
OPT OnDemand maintains over 4,000 SKUs in local stock, with additional products available through daily just-in-time delivery. They provide rapid turnaround times of 24-48 hours from order import to shipping, and offer global dropshipping services through various carriers.
The company caters primarily to B2B online sellers, providing comprehensive logistics solutions that include pick, pack, and ship services for stored ready-made products. They also offer customer service support seven days a week, helping businesses manage their fulfillment needs without maintaining their own inventory or production facilities.
Their production capacity is substantial, with capabilities like producing up to 15,000 screen-printed items per day. The company positions itself as a complete fulfillment solution for businesses looking to outsource their production, warehousing, and shipping operations.

So sorry for the many many wrinkles on the Gildan 5000, but it was in the laundry and I did not want to iron the dirt into it
I’ve had both since about the middle of last year, and they’ve both been used regularly.
The Gildan 5000 has a rough texture, not scratchy though. I wouldn’t call it soft, but it is pleasantly flexible, sits loosely and comfortably and follows every movement well.
The cut is slightly flared towards the bottom, the sleeves are wide and directed to the side.
It shrinks a little in length, but the width stays pretty much the same.
On a white shirt the colors fade very much at first, on black they fade just minimal. The white shirt is a warm-white color.
I did not test sleeve print on it by now.
Slight pilling from beginn on, a bit more in the arm area.
The STTU is woven much finer and more evenly, and it falls smoother and more elegantly. It is a bit firmer, but not stiff.
The cut is very straight, so depending on the shirt size and the stature, it can “sit” a little on the hips and then hang loosely around the middle. The sleeves are cut a little narrower. For sporting activities not my first choice, because the cut of the sleeves is slightly downward, and the neckline rises slightly when you raise your arms. Think of it like when you say you´re wearing your good shirt today it is this one
It feels comfortable, and it looks and feels high quality. Definitely suitable for semi-formal occasions.
It holds shape extremly well, and the print on white does fade only minimal. It is the whitest white shirt I´ve ever seen, very clean and a slightly cool white.
I would not recommend doing sleeve prints on other than white, because there is too much movement and stretching going on there and the pre-base will tear and peel of very fast. It started with the first washing.
No pilling by now.

OptOnDemand Czech Republic
I love the great print quality itself and the fast production and shipping, but howewer I will not order from them again. The prints on the white shirts fade tremendous very fast, and I had two black shirts from them and both had the lightened/discolored rectangle where the printing plate was. (I have also a white Gildan 64000 from them which faded equally, but I have no before-picture from it.) Too sad, the prints themself are great und very accurate with details, but that´s useless if they don´t hold up
Washed inside out 30 C, no fabric softener, hang dry.
